WebChemical exposure to any part of the eye or eyelid may result in a chemical eye burn. Chemical burns represent 7%-10% of eye injuries. About 15%-20% of burns to the face involve at least one eye ... WebQuickly and gently blot gasoline off the face. Immediately flush the contaminated eye (s) with lukewarm, gently flowing water for 5 minutes, while holding the eyelid (s) open. If irritation, redness or pain persists, see an eye doctor. Click to Keep Reading Household Products Read more Poisoning Read more NIH MedlinePlus Magazine Read more Was this page helpful? tin foil art for preschoolersGetting a small amount of gasoline on the skin for a short period of time is usually harmless. The skin does not readily absorb the chemicals in gasoline. However, if gasoline remains on the skin or clothing for a few hours, it can enter the skin.
